I am an experienced, active and successful fantasy hockey GM. My two current Fantrax dynasty teams are in 1st and 2nd place. I do not play for money, but I am willing to pay for a portion of the Fantrax Premium service.

The league needs to have a salary cap (with true NHL salaries) and a decent sized minor league roster (25+). Ideally the league size is between 10 and 20 teams. Leagues based only using goals and assists categories aren't interesting. Roto, Points and H2H leagues are all fine.

I don't mind taking over a basement team as long as there are rules in place that promote activity and parity.

Post opportunities here or PM to discuss your league opening. May be interested in more than one league.
